Beyond the translation

Overall song meaning

Varaaga Nadhikkarai Oram from the film Sangamam (1999) expresses the deep longing and heartache born from love at first sight. The protagonist reminisces about catching a fleeting glimpse of his beloved on the banks of the Varaha River, after which she vanished like a dream. Post that encounter, all other worldly visual sights irritate his eyes, while her unseen form sweetens his internal vision. Through vivid imagery—comparing her to a five-colored parrot, describing the inner turmoil as a game of kabaddi, and imagining catching her shadow—the song captures the intense visceral reaction to sudden love.

Writing craft

Poetic devices

Onomatopoeia / Irattai Klavi (இரட்டைக் கிளவி)

Kannu dhakku dhakku dhakkungudhu…oaoaoa

Use of sound words like 'dhakku dhakku', 'dhikku dhikku', and 'jallu jallu' to rhythmically represent bodily sensations of excitement and anxiety.

Metaphor / Uruvagam (உருவகம்)

Panjavarnakkili nee parandha pinnaalum anju varnam nenjil irukku

Comparing the beloved to a 'Panjavarnakkili' (five-colored parrot) whose vibrant colors remain imprinted on his heart even after her departure.

Hyperbole / Uyarvu Navirchi (உயர்வு நவிற்சி)

Nee enna kadandhu pogayilae un nizhala pidichukitten / Nizhalukkulla... kudi irukken

An exaggerated expression of devotion where the lover claims to physically catch her shadow and reside inside it.

Monai / Initial Rhyme (மோனை)

Kannil varum kaatchiyellaam kanmaniyae uruthum

Repetition of the 'Ka' initial consonant sound across words ('Kannil', 'kaatchiyellaam', 'kanmaniyae') creating melodic flow.
